Ingredients
Peanuts ( 50 grams ) | Mung beans ( 50g ) |
Water-milled glutinous rice flour ( 150g ) | White sugar ( 2 spoons ) |
Warm water ( appropriate amount ) | Dry water-milled glutinous rice flour ( appropriate amount ) |
How to make glutinous rice balls with peanut and mung bean paste
-

1.Put the peanuts into the pot and stir-fry until cooked.Keep the heat low throughout.

2. Fry the peanut skin until there are cracks on the surface and let it cool.

3.Peel the peanuts, put them in a fresh-keeping bag, and use a rolling pin to crush them into pieces.

4. Pour the crushed peanuts into a plate and set aside.

5. Put the mung beans in the pot and pour water and cook for half an hour (the mung beans are best in advance Soak it in the evening, and the cooking time does not need to be too long).Check it frequently while cooking to avoid drying the pot.If the mung beans are out of water and are not yet cooked, add more water.

6. Just cook the mung beans like this.

7. Let the cooked mung beans warm, pour them into a blender and smash them until they are a little soupy.does not matter.

8.Pour the mung beans into the wok, add two spoons of sugar, and stir-fry until the sugar melts , collect excess water.

9. It would be great if this is the case.

10. Add water little by little to the glutinous rice flour and knead it into a ball.Let it wake up for half an hour.

11. Divide into dough of similar size.

12.Mold it into a wine cup shape with your hands.

13.Put the filling.Don’t put too much filling, otherwise it will be difficult to knead.

14.Knead it well and roll it in dry glutinous rice flour, then roll it into a round shape with your hands..

15.I did it one by one, because I did it by feeling, so Some are inconsistent in size.

16. Boil water in a pot, put the glutinous rice balls in and cook.

17. Take them out one by one, roll them on the plate and wrap them in crushed peanuts.

Tips
1.Add or reduce sugar according to your own taste.I don’t like sweets very much, so I added two spoons.
2.Take out the glutinous rice balls one by one and wrap them in crushed peanuts.Too many glutinous rice balls will easily stick together.
